Leviticus 7:10
The Guilt Offering
9Likewise, every grain offering that is baked in an oven or cooked in a pan or on a griddle belongs to the priest who presents it,10and every grain offering, whether dry or mixed with oil, belongs equally to all the sons of Aaron.
